Apple announced last week that more than 15 billion app’s have been downloaded from their App Store. top free iphone appsHere are some other numbers revealed:

- More than 425,000 app’s of all kinds
- More than 100,000 app’s specifically for the iPad
- 20 categories of app’s
- App’s available in 90 countries
- More than 200 million iOS devices sold
- $2.5 billion dollars paid out to developers

And here some interesting iPhone apps reality check:
According to Communities Dominate Brands:

– 85% of all downloadable apps are free

– The proportion of spending on apps is under 3% of the amount spent on the device

– The average app development cost is between $15,000 and $50,000 dollars

– For an investment of of $35,000 in an app that gets average downloads, it would take 10 years to recoup its development costs
